OnePlus has officially launched its latest tablet, the OnePlus Pad Go 2, in India, marking a significant addition to the company’s expanding portfolio of consumer electronics. The device is designed to cater to a growing market for tablets, particularly among users seeking a balance of performance, portability, and affordability.
The OnePlus Pad Go 2 features a large 7,700 mAh battery, which the company claims can provide up to 12 hours of usage on a single charge. This substantial battery capacity is aimed at users who require extended use for tasks such as streaming, gaming, and productivity applications. The tablet also supports fast charging, allowing users to quickly recharge the device when needed.
In terms of display, the OnePlus Pad Go 2 is equipped with a 10.61-inch LCD panel that boasts a resolution of 2000 x 1200 pixels. The display supports a 60Hz refresh rate, which is standard for devices in this category, and offers a peak brightness of 500 nits. This combination of specifications is intended to deliver a vibrant viewing experience for multimedia consumption and general use.
One of the standout features of the OnePlus Pad Go 2 is its support for stylus input, which is becoming increasingly popular among tablet users for note-taking, drawing, and other creative tasks. The tablet is compatible with the OnePlus Stylo, a stylus designed to enhance productivity and creativity. This feature positions the OnePlus Pad Go 2 as a viable option for students and professionals alike, who may benefit from the precision and versatility that a stylus provides.
The tablet is powered by a MediaTek Dimensity 6100 processor, which is designed to deliver efficient performance for everyday tasks and multitasking. Accompanying the processor are options for 8GB of RAM and 128GB of internal storage, expandable via a microSD card slot. This configuration is aimed at ensuring smooth operation, whether users are browsing the web, streaming content, or running multiple applications simultaneously.
In terms of connectivity, the OnePlus Pad Go 2 supports Wi-Fi 6, which offers faster internet speeds and improved performance in crowded environments. The tablet also features Bluetooth 5.3, allowing for seamless connections with a variety of peripherals, including headphones and keyboards.

The pricing for the OnePlus Pad Go 2 starts at INR 19,999 (approximately USD 240), positioning it competitively within the mid-range tablet segment. This pricing strategy is likely to attract budget-conscious consumers who are looking for a feature-rich tablet without the premium price tag associated with higher-end models.
